This is kind of neat. We learned yesterday that the demo for 38 Studios' Kingdoms of Amalur: Reckoning is coming to Xbox Live on January 17 in advance of its February 7 release. There will also be a Mass Effect 3 demo coming before Reckoning's release. Now Electronic Arts confirms that playing either one will unlock content in the other game.
The Reckoning demo will include a gameplay tutorial and a timed 45-minute jaunt through a section of the game's open world. Players will also be given the opportunity to create and customize a character. There's no release timeframe given for the ME3 demo, beyond the press release noting that, by playing it, "fans will unlock... items for Reckoning when the game launches on February 7," which suggests that said demo will arrive BEFORE the release date.
Check out the details for all of this unlockable content after the jump.
Polishing off the Reckoning demo and watching the trailer that plays at the end will unlock the following items in Mass Effect 3:
- Reckoner Knight Armor: This armor will maximize damage done in close-quarters combat while a beefed–up power cell feeds energy into weapon systems to increase projectile velocity.
- The Chakram Launcher: This weapon uses a fabricator to manufacture lightweight, explosive ammunition discs.
Install and play the Mass Effect 3 demo to unlock the following items in Reckoning:
- N7 Armor: Players can unlock special armor inspired by Commander Shepard’s iconic N7 battle armor including Helm, Cuirass, Gauntlets, Chausses and Greaves.
- Onmiblade Daggers: A holographic blade stemming from Commander Shepard’s Omni-Tool, the Omni-blade allows players to stab enemies in close combat.
